Cool will do, also if you end up getting that sunset Millie I advise to use some kind of potassium additive. I noticed I lost the fuzzyness on mine until I started dosing potassium

Just outside of Columbus. New Albany area. He built a farm on his property and has a huge green house. You can check out the web site for more details on the setup, but he doesn't keep it up to date very well on coral selection. He mainly does aquaculture and never sells the main colony, but frags it to get what he sells. I do believe he orders in as well, but most is aquaculture.
